Adolescents with and without Autism Use Similar Strategies When Inferring Mental States from Facial Expressions

Abstract

This study investigated the strategies used to infer mental states from dynamic facial expressions in adolescents with Autism Spectrum Disorders (ASD). Bayesian analyses revealed that adolescents with ASD are fast and accurate at inferring mental states. They also spontaneously fixate the eyes. Findings imply their mentalising abilities have been underestimated.
